PIPER PA-28-180 accident at Farmington, NM, 17 Nov 2021

Farmington, NM, United States

On November 17, 2021, a PIPER PA-28-180 operated by RED ROCK FLYING SCHOOL LLC was involved in an aviation accident near Farmington, NM. No fatalities were reported. Investigators recorded the probable cause as: The pilot’s inadequate fuel management which resulted in a total loss of engine power due to fuel starvation.
